Hi! I’m a Program Administrator with Civil Air Patrol, where I help keep things running smoothly so our members—especially our cadets—can focus on what really matters: growing as leaders and exploring the world of aviation.
One of the coolest parts of this job is watching young people discover that flying isn’t just exciting—it’s a real career path, one that’s meaningful, challenging, and full of opportunities. Whether it’s through aerospace education, hands-on training, or leadership experiences, we’re not just shaping future pilots—we’re shaping confident, capable people ready to serve and lead in any field.
I’m proud to be part of a team that builds character, supports community, and makes aviation feel accessible and awesome!
